Output e9effb78f13987e3776fe005bfe3094ddc1089666fa31dfdf3ec39ae11e01a11:1

value
18589034
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e1176e4726591defe07f375ebe37c8e87724530 OP_EQUALVERIFY OP_CHECKSIG
address
16fBpLtVH7CQwCu154wTFm1exP3y1WPAvD
transaction
e9effb78f13987e3776fe005bfe3094ddc1089666fa31dfdf3ec39ae11e01a11
confirmations
442388
spent
true